National Semiconductor and Brown-Forman beat Q4 expectations

The fourth quarter turned out to be a good one for National Semiconductor Corp. (NASDAQ: NSM) and Brown-Forman Corp. (NYSE: BF.B), producer of Jack Daniels Tennessee Whiskey. On Thursday, both companies reported results that beat Wall Street forecasts.

For the quarter ended May 5, National Semiconductor, the Santa Clara, Calif.-based chip maker, reported net income of $83.2 million, or 34 cents per share. Revenue rose to $462 million from $455.9 million in the year-ago period.

Analysts polled by Thomson Financial expected income of 26 cents per share on revenue of $449.5 million.

For the full fiscal year, National Semiconductor recorded net income of $332.3 million, or $1.26 per share, and revenue slipped to $1.89 billion from $1.93 billion.

The company also forecast fiscal first-quarter revenue of $460 million to $475 million, compared to analysts' expectations of $451.2 million.

Shares of National Semiconductor rose 78 cents, or 3.6%, to close at $22.66, and climbed another $2.13, or 9.4% in after-hours trading.
